Transaction 70757c8fa37e391a9f34d1a2b90e2644ab5b376383f7bd24dde418b94e0b8d2e

1 Input
2 Outputs
  • 70757c8fa37e391a9f34d1a2b90e2644ab5b376383f7bd24dde418b94e0b8d2e:0
  • value  40075873483
    address  1NFqwV1W1QeiXKVwwasaeTrEur5PZ8V5PC
  • 70757c8fa37e391a9f34d1a2b90e2644ab5b376383f7bd24dde418b94e0b8d2e:1
  • value  2004790000
    address  1Agp3XRiNUgC9XpG9GJ5JaW2fPmaqdZB4k